Readiness and Procedure
Before performing a car paint job, it is essential to thoroughly prep the vehicle to ensure the best outcomes. Start by giving panel beating to remove any debris, grime, or contaminants from the exterior. Pay particular attention to areas around the wheels, under the bumpers, and any corners and crevices where dirt might accumulate. Wipe the car completely to prevent any moisture from interfering with the painting process.
Once the vehicle is clean, assess the surface for any flaws that may need to be fixed. This includes marks, dings, or rust spots. These issues should be repaired before paint is applied to achieve a seamless finish. Use sandpaper to smooth rough areas and fill in any dings with suitable fillers. After repairs, a detailed covering of the surrounding parts, including windows and trim, is necessary to protect them from paint mist.
With the preparations complete, it is moment to move on to the actual painting process. Using a premium primer, apply a foundation to create a level foundation for the paint. Once the primer is set, the color coat can be applied in uniform layers. This step is crucial for achieving that stunning look, so patience and attention to detail are vital. Finally, after the color is set, a clear coat will seal and protect the new paint, giving it a glossy finish that shines.
Preserving Your Car’s New Look
After your car has received a high-quality paint service, maintaining its updated appearance is essential. Consistent washing is necessary to remove dirt and road grime that can accumulate and diminish the paint. Use a mild car soap and avoid automatic car washes with brushes, as they can create scratches. Instead, choose handwashing or touchless car washes to maintain the finish in top condition.
Besides washing, putting on wax or paint sealant every few months can greatly prolong the life of your car’s new finish. Wax provides a coat against UV rays and contaminants, while sealants offer durable durability. Pay attention to areas that are exposed to harsh elements, as these spots may call for more consistent treatments to maintain their shine.
Lastly, think about parking your car in covered areas whenever you can. Prolonged exposure to sunlight can lead to fading and damage over time. If you can, employ a car cover when parked for extended periods. Through these simple steps, you can ensure that your car continues to shine gorgeously long after its paint service.
